Stopped by here on a whim and was very impressed. The food was all great except for the Italian Cream Cake. We had chicken parmesan and the pasta sampler and both definitely came home with us. We also had a side of alfredo sauce for dipping our bread and took the rest of it home too. The salads were pretty good but seemed a tad bit small.
We did stop by on a Saturday evening before the dinner rush started and it seemed like they were only going to have one waitress and maybe one cook the entire time? I wasn’t sure if there was anyone else in the back but one waitress on a Saturday seemed odd for sure. They were even warned they were going to have a party of at least 15 coming in from the hotel.
We wouldn’t make a drive to Schulenburg just for this restaurant but if we pass through we would stop again. For small town Italian it is fantastic.
